Market problem

No Anroid Market / Google Play

It doesnt have Android Market nor Google Play officially. Of course it can unofficially be installed, but that doesnt fix the compatibility of applicaltions.

Amazon Market

[Leader Interational INC], the author of this tablet, suggests installing Amazon Market in one of the papers which come with this device. This has a problem that you must give credit card details even with free applicaltions. I dont have credit card!

F-Droid

F-Droid is the solution for this problem. It describes itself as “an easily-installable catalogue of FOSS (Free and Open Source Software) applications for the Android platform.”.

ADB logcat doesnt work.

  1. I have plugged the USB cable.
  2. USB debugging reports to be on.
  3. Device detects the cable.
  4. I have tested ADB with another device and it worked.

Its good that at least alogcat works. I havent tested other features of adb yet.

What happens when I run it? Nothing as you can see below.

% adb logcat
* daemon not running. starting it now on port 5037 *
* daemon started successfully *
- waiting for device -
